Affiliation of Chemistry and Biology
Understanding living organisms needs a thorough sight that integrates both chemistry and biology. This interconnection is crucial for grasping the fundamental processes that sustain life. At the molecular level, organic functions are driven by chemical interactions, where the concepts of chemistry illuminate the behavior of biomolecules such as proteins, nucleic acids, carbohydrates, and lipids.
For circumstances, the framework of DNA, a cornerstone of biological inheritance, is deeply rooted in chemical concepts, consisting of hydrogen bonding and molecular geometry. Enzymatic reactions, important for metabolic paths, exemplify the catalytic function of proteins, which are themselves developed with elaborate biochemical procedures involving amino acids and peptide bonds.
Furthermore, cellular respiration and photosynthesis highlight the synergy in between chemical reactions and biochemical pathways, showcasing just how microorganisms transform power and issue to prosper. Real-World Developments and applications
The intersection of Science education in chemistry and biology has actually led to groundbreaking real-world applications and technologies that substantially effect various areas, including medication, farming, and environmental Science. Recognizing the chemical processes within biological systems makes it possible for the advancement of targeted treatments and tailored medicine. Improvements in biochemistry and biology have promoted the creation of biologic medications that treat complicated conditions like cancer and autoimmune conditions, showcasing the potent harmony in between these disciplines.
In agriculture, the principles of chemistry and biology merge to improve plant yields and sustainability. Developments such as genetically changed organisms (GMOs) utilize genetic modification to create plants resistant to bugs and ecological stressors, consequently addressing food safety obstacles. Additionally, the application of biopesticides and biofertilizers represents a shift in the direction of more sustainable farming techniques that decrease chemical inputs.
Environmental Science additionally gains from this interdisciplinary approach, as bioremediation techniques harness microbial processes to tidy up infected websites. The assimilation of chemistry and biology promotes a detailed understanding of ecological community characteristics, advertising innovative techniques for biodiversity conservation and climate adjustment reduction.
